Output 33ff8b51a677868704cd1859957c33eabfe416b62a43cbb523885192a6049964: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b580cdf8be61cf4030808a28a852a2a49735236 OP_EQUAL
address
ADtewJzWfjfmojZ4BJK7qxErq7HEYfMyHK
transaction
33ff8b51a677868704cd1859957c33eabfe416b62a43cbb523885192a6049964